WebIn one molecule of glucose, there are 12 hydrogen, 6 carbon, and 6 oxygen atoms. So, altogether, the molar mass of a single molecule of glucose is equal to: 1.0079 (12)+12.0107 (6)+15.9994 (6) = 180.16 g/mol. Glucose has a molar mass of 180.16 g/mol. One mole of glucose molecule has a mass of 180.16 g.

Maltose occurs to a limited extent in sprouting grain. It is formed most often by the partial hydrolysis of starch and glycogen. In the manufacture of beer, maltose is liberated by the action of malt (germinating barley) on starch; for this reason, it is often referred to as malt sugar.Maltose is about 30% as sweet as sucrose.
